At launch, Far Cry 4 was programmed to require a CPU with at least four logical cores. When launched on a system with a dual-core processor—like the many budget-friendly Intel Pentium and AMD Athlon models—the game's executable would stall at a black screen immediately upon startup.

: The combination of Extreme Injector and a dedicated dualcore.dll intercepts the game engine's system requests during startup. It mimics the behavior of a quad-core layout, allowing the initial execution scripts to clear the hardware check bottleneck. Essential Prerequisites Before Setup
